China is an instigator in the India/ Pakistan scenario. China claims that Pakistan seceded the Kashmir region to China in 1964.

China in the DPRK scenario doesn't want to deal with the millions of DPRK refugees. They already have an issue with illegal immigration. Given that China had a few billion that they try to support in a socialist based system, they do not want to add unskilled workers who would be dependent on assistance to their population. Eventually, the economic growth rate of China will slow down and they will not be able to subsidize everything that they do. If China is smart they will start to wean subsidies now before they encounter economic turmoil within the next couple decades.

Pakistan is part of the process of bottling up Iran which has been ongoing since the early 80s. You look at our "friends" in the Middle East and Central Asia and the conflicts we've fought since the end of the Cold War. Nearly all surround Iran and have kept it in check to an extent.
